Petrol prices in Pakistan have become a major concern for the public as the latest update shows a sharp increase. As of now, the current petrol price has reached around PKR 458.40 per litre, making it one of the highest rates in recent years.

This sudden rise is mainly due to increasing global oil prices and the weakening Pakistani rupee. Since Pakistan depends heavily on imported fuel, any change in international markets directly affects local prices.

The impact of this price hike is being felt across the country. Transportation costs have increased, leading to higher fares for buses, ride-hailing services, and delivery charges. At the same time, the prices of daily essentials like food and groceries are also rising due to increased logistics costs.

Businesses and industries are also under pressure, as higher fuel costs increase production and operational expenses. This situation contributes to overall inflation, making life more difficult for the common citizen.

Experts believe that petrol prices may continue to fluctuate in the coming months depending on global oil trends and government policies. The next official revision is expected soon, which could either bring relief or further increase prices.

In conclusion, the rising petrol price in Pakistan is not just a fuel issue—it directly affects the economy and daily life. People are now looking for ways to manage expenses, reduce travel, and adapt to this ongoing situation.
